Job Title: Clinical Research Nurse

Job Description

This role provides specialized nursing care to participants enrolled in clinical trials, with a focus on chemotherapy, immunotherapy, and investigational agents. The Clinical Research Nurse administers study treatments, performs protocol-driven procedures, monitors participant safety, and ensures accurate documentation in compliance with applicable regulations and Standard Operating Procedures. This position plays a key role in supporting high-quality clinical research while prioritizing participant dignity, health, safety, and welfare.

Responsibilities

  • Administer chemotherapy, immunotherapy, and investigational agents, including parenteral therapies, in accordance with study protocols and applicable regulations.
  • Perform study-related clinical procedures such as venipuncture, obtaining blood specimens, peripheral IV insertion, and venous access device (central line) management.
  • Collect biological samples strictly following the study protocol and Standard Operating Procedures.
  • Perform ECG collection and obtain vital signs as required by the clinical trial protocol.
  • Use nursing assessment skills to monitor participants' general well-being and identify potential adverse events during and after study treatment.
  • Document clinical observations, adverse events, and all relevant data accurately and completely according to the protocol and Standard Operating Procedures.
  • Respond promptly and appropriately to emergency situations using established nursing standards and clinical judgment.
  • Educate, explain, and inform participants about study procedures, expectations, and their role in the clinical trial.
  • Provide patient education on chemotherapy, immunotherapy, and investigational agent administration, including potential side effects and symptom management.
  • Ensure that participant dignity, health, safety, and welfare remain the highest priority at all times throughout the course of the study.
  • Work effectively and efficiently under tight deadlines, managing high volumes of work and multiple interruptions while maintaining accuracy and quality.
  • Utilize electronic medical record (EMR) systems to document care, treatments, and study-related data in a timely and accurate manner.

Work Environment

This position operates in a fast-paced clinical research setting that supports high volumes of participants and study activities. The role follows a daytime schedule, typically from 7:30 a.m. to 5:00 p.m., requiring consistent on-site presence during these hours. Nurses regularly use electronic medical record (EMR) systems and standard clinical equipment such as IV supplies, venous access devices, ECG machines, and vital sign monitors. The environment emphasizes strict adherence to study protocols, regulatory requirements, and Standard Operating Procedures while maintaining a professional, patient-centered atmosphere focused on safety, accuracy, and high-quality care.
